Kurt Drummond Reassigned to Generals

October 8, 2002 - ECHL (ECHL)
Greensboro Generals News Release


Greensboro, NC — The Greensboro Generals of the East Coast Hockey League (ECHL) have received defenseman Kurt Drummond from the American Hockey League after being re-assigned by the Rochester Americans. Drummond will be in the lineup for Greensboro on opening night at the Lexington Men O'War this Friday night at 7:30.

Drummond played for the ECHL's Wheeling Nailers last season, leading their defensive corps with twelve goals and 34 assists for 46 points.

The Generals' opening night roster will be released on Wednesday in preparation for Friday's season opener.

The Generals' home opener is Friday, October 25 at 7:30 against the Reading Royals.
